I have DD's and the stick on bra's dont do anything for me so Id imagine it wouldn't be much better for a D. I have a Fine Lines convertible lace bra that I got from Myer for my year 10 formal that has really great lift in it....its got a low back and if you really want extra support you can turn the straps halter neck....but like I said Ive got big boobies and they look great in this strapless bra.

Escada also make fantastic push up bras for bigger boobies, but its upwards of $500 for D-DD.
I'm a C-cup myself, and have friends that are D-cups (and dancers, to boot!!! eeek, the bouncing). They've used the adhesive Braza Bras, and they work fine for them.

however each to their own - we're all shaped a bit differently so it might be more fitting for some and less so for others. Failing that, Fine Lines is the bestest brand in the whole entire world, second only to Elle Macpherson (my advice is that you get one of those, the bra fits lovely and will last for a nice long time).

Mind you, I still prefer the stick-on Braza Bra (not the chicken fillet thing). Don't any of you other C+ cup girls get terrible neck pains/red marks from thin halter straps (including bra straps)?!?!?!?!
